Nvidia: The Titan of AI Technology
Nvidia, with its iconic green logo, has become synonymous with AI. Founded in 1993, Nvidia initially carved its niche in the graphics processing unit (GPU) market. But fast forward to now, and the company has evolved into the backbone of numerous AI applications. From self-driving cars to sophisticated machine learning algorithms powering search engines, Nvidia’s GPUs turbocharge compute power, enabling transformative work in AI.
The Power of GPUs
At the heart of Nvidia’s impressive performance is its line of GPUs, specifically the A100 and H100 series. These chips have redefined speed and performance in AI tasks, inspiring organizations worldwide—from tech giants like Google and Amazon to startups innovating in their basements. The demand for these chips has surged with the increase in AI adoption, allowing Nvidia to enjoy remarkable revenue growth.

CoreWeave: The Rising Star of AI Infrastructure
On the newer side of the spectrum lies CoreWeave, which aims to democratize access to high-performance computing resources for companies looking to innovate with AI. Founded in 2017, CoreWeave operates as a cloud-based GPU computing platform that specializes in providing elastic infrastructure for various AI applications, from rendering graphics to machine learning workloads.
Innovative Business Model
CoreWeave’s focus on serving niche markets—such as visual effects studios, animation houses, and AI developers—sets it apart in the crowded tech space. The company’s cloud services allow clients to spin up necessary resources without the hefty upfront investment tied to owning physical servers. This flexibility is appealing to a growing number of startups and established firms eager to pursue AI projects without being bogged down by infrastructure limitations.
